The work they do is critical to the future of competitive organizations today.” “…business can’t wait for someone to tell them the “best” way to do this, they have to do this work today and there just aren’t enough knowledgeable skilled people to go around.” - Brett Champlin - President of the ABPMP BPM Strategies October 2006 The world needs to accelerate the formation competent BPM Professionals to overcome the enormous challenges ahead.GeorgiaH o m e o f t h e P e a c h P r o c e s s !What is the BPM CBOK™? BPM is a constantly evolving discipline. BPM evolves based on practical experience and academic research. BPM knowledge is assembled in books, articles, blogs, presentations, process models and best practices. The BPM Common Body of Knowledge (BPM CBOK™) provides BPM Professionals a comprehensive overview of the issues, best practices and lessons learned commonly practiced as collected by the ABPMP. GeorgiaH o m e o f t h e P e a c h P r o c e s s !Why is the CBOK™ important?GeorgiaH o m e o f t h e P e a c h P r o c e s s !Who created the CBOK™? The development and management of the Guide to the BPM CBOK™ is the responsibility of the Education Committee within the ABPMP.  At this time, the Guide will only be provided to solicit input from ABPMP professional members and recognized industry experts who are members of the ABPMP Education Committee Advisory Group. Subsequent releases will be made available to the general public.CBOK™ Knowledge AreasProcess Process Process Process Process Perform.ModelingAnalysisDesignTrnsfrm.Mngmt.GeorgiaH o m e o f t h e P e a c h P r o c e s s !Business Process Management• BPM is a disciplined approach to identify, design, execute, document, measure, monitor, and control both automated and non-automated business processes to achieve consistent, targeted results aligned with an organization’s strategic goals. • This section explains key concepts such business, process, customer value, the nature of cross-functional work, process types, process components, BPM lifecycle, critical skills and success factorsGeorgiaH o m e o f t h e P e a c h P r o c e s s !BPM.Process Modeling Process Modeling enables people to understand, communicate, measure, and manage the primary components of business processes.  This section explains the purpose and benefits of process modeling, a discussion of the types and uses of process models, and the tools, techniques, and modeling standards.
